Intel Core i5-12600H Benchmark, Test and specs

Last updated:
The Intel Core i5-12600H was released in Q1/2022 and has 12 cores. The processor can process 16 threads simultaneously and uses a mainboard with the socket BGA 1744.

CPU Cores and Base Frequency

The Intel Core i5-12600H has 12 cores. The clock frequency of the Intel Core i5-12600H is 2.00 GHz (4.50 GHz). An initial performance assessment can be made using the number of CPU cores.

CPU Cores / Threads: 12 / 16
Core architecture: hybrid (big.LITTLE)
A-Core: 4x Golden Cove
B-Core: 8x Gracemont
Hyperthreading / SMT: Yes
Overclocking: No
A-Core Frequency: 2.00 GHz (4.50 GHz)
B-Core Frequency: 2.00 GHz (3.30 GHz)

Internal Graphics

The Intel Core i5-12600H has an integrated graphics that the system can use to efficiently play back videos. The Intel Core i5-12600H has the Intel Iris Xe Graphics 80 (Alder Lake) installed, which has 80 streaming multiprocessors (640 shaders).

GPU name: Intel Iris Xe Graphics 80 (Alder Lake)
GPU frequency: 0.40 GHz
GPU (Turbo): 1.40 GHz
Compute units: 80
Shader: 640

Memory & PCIe

The Intel Core i5-12600H supports a maximum of 64 GB memory. Depending on the mainboard, the processor can use a maximum of 2 (Dual Channel) memory channels. This results in a maximum bandwidth of the main memory of 83.2 GB/s.

Thermal Management

The Intel Core i5-12600H has a TDP of 45 W. Based on the TDP, the system manufacturer can and must adapt the cooling solution to the processor.

TDP (PL1 / PBP): 45 W
TDP (PL2): 95 W
TDP up: --
TDP down: --
Tjunction max.: 100 °C
